Dunkin’ Donuts Releases Breakfast Sandwich with Chicken Apple Sausage

For those looking for non-donut options during the morning drive, Dunkin’ Donuts is releasing a new breakfast sandwich for their “better-for-you” menu. Called the Sausage Apple Chicken Sandwich, it’s the first Dunkin’ Donuts menu item to feature chicken apple sausage.

The sandwich is made with an egg, reduced-fat cheddar cheese, a split chicken-apple sausage seasoned with spices and served on an English Muffin. While the Sausage Apple Chicken Sandwich is quite a mouthful, it’s only 400 calories.

Still, we won’t judge you if you pair this with a glazed donut.
